Logo
HCL Technologies

TECHNICAL ARCHITECT

HCL Technologies, Wilmington, North Carolina, United States, 28412


Job Description (Posting).

" Required Skills8-10 years of professional experience in Salesforce Design and Implementation.Should have in-depth experience in Salesforce (SFDC) CRM with end to end implementation experience.Strong knowledge of consuming APIs (SOAP, REST). Salesforce.com integration experience, including between different business systems as well as working with integration tools.Proficiency in programming using Salesforce SFDC, Force.com, JavaScript, and XML and their use in the development of CRM solutions.Strong experience with configuration, customization, programming with APEX APIs, APEX Triggers, and implementing new instances of Salesforce.com from scratch.Strong practical deployment knowledge of Salesforce Lightning UI, VisualForce, Flex, Salesforce configurations, Apex classes, APEX Web services, API, AppExchange deployment, and Salesforce.com s-controls.Ability to define the system landscape, to identify gaps between current and desired end-states, and deliver a CRM solution.Must have excellent written, verbal and listening communication skills and be able to prioritize and deliver the most important things first.Experience with SFDX, Git source control, CICD is a plusFamiliar with middleware and enterprise integration patternsData modelling and relational databasesGood knowledge of software development lifecycle and continuous integrationResponsibilitiesHands on experience in the overall Salesforce architecture, application design and development of the system (including Sales, Service, Marketing, Communities and Vlocity).Bridge functional gaps of the Salesforce application that cannot be realized with configuration and declarative development with the help of coding and programmatic extensions using Apex Lightning Components etc.Responsible for the development of new and enhancements of existing SFDC Platform and Force.com cloud-based applications, including systems analysis, design, development, implementation, and maintenance.Responsible for developing in Visualforce, Apex, Java, AJAX, and other technologies to build customized solutions that support business requirements and drive key business decisions.Experience in designing and developing software components and having a very strong Service Oriented Architecture and integration background.Salesforce.com integration experience, including between different business systems as well as working with integration tools and developing custom integration solutions.Technical leadership, setting best practices including integration and application development, deployment, testing (unit and systems), and iterative refinement.Design, implement and support features for the Salesforce Communities Knowledge project Job Requirements." (1.) To be responsible for providing technical guidance to a team of developers, enhancing their technical capabilities and increasing productivity. (2.) To conduct comprehensive code reviews, establish and oversee quality assurance processes, performance optimization , implementation of best practices and coding standards to ensure succeful delivery of complex projects. (3.) To ensure process compliance in the assigned module, and participate in technical discussionsorreview as a technical consultant for feasibility study (technical alternatives, best packages, supporting architecture best practices, technical risks, breakdown into components, estimations). (4.) To collaborate with stakeholders to define project scope, objectives, deliverables and accordingly prepare and submit status reports for minimizing exposure and closure of escalations.